Gumdal - Doma, Vikarabad
Gumdal is a village situated in the Doma mandal of Vikarabad district, Telangana. It is located approximately 14 km from Doma and around 109 km from Hyderabad. Gumdal village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Gumdal is 574557. The village covers a total geographical area of 811 hectares and falls under the 509335 pincode. Vicarabad is the nearest town, located about 45 km away.
Gumdal village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Gumdal
As per Census 2011, Gumdal village has a total population of 2,412 people, consisting of 1,213 males and 1,199 females. The village has 409 households and a sex ratio of 988 females per 1,000 males. There are 402 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 778 literate and 1,634 illiterate residents. Additionally, 598 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 298 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Gumdal are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 2,412 | 1,213 | 1,199 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 402 | 188 | 214 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 598 | 297 | 301 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 298 | 154 | 144 |
| Literate Population | 778 | 476 | 302 |
| Illiterate Population | 1,634 | 737 | 897 |

Transport and Connectivity of Gumdal
Gumdal is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Vicarabad to Gumdal is about 45 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.3 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Hyderabad to Gumdal is about 109 km, with the usual travel time around ~3.1 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Gumdal
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Gumdal village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| Yes | Available within village |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 5-10 km |
Health Facilities in Gumdal
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Gumdal village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
